How Does Desertification Manifest in Kyrgyzstan, and What Do Pastures Have to Do with It?

16 September 2026

These questions became the main topic of a live broadcast on Radio Sputnik Kyrgyzstan featuring experts from the PF “CAMP Alatoo”. Maksat Miynazarov, Project Coordinator for the Foundation's Sustainable Land Management Program, spoke about the outcomes of participating in the Conference of the Parties to the UN Convention to Combat Desertification (UNCCD), which took place in Ulaanbaatar, Mongolia. Among 11 participating countries, Kyrgyzstan presented its practical experience in combating land degradation.

In response to the host's question about the relevance of this issue to a country where mountains cover 90% of the territory, specific statistics were cited.

"Desertification manifests through land degradation. According to UNCCD research, about 9.5% of land in Kyrgyzstan is degraded. This means that such soil cannot support the survival and normal growth of plants. The hardest hit are village-adjacent pastures located near settlements. One of the primary drivers of this process is the annual increase in livestock population," the expert explained.

Maksat Miynazarov shared that PF “CAMP Alatoo” makes a substantial contribution to solving the degradation problem. Specialists develop and test various tools that local communities—who have been the primary resource users since 2009—successfully apply in practice. These include methodologies for assessing pasture vegetation cover, monitoring pasturelands, and developing digital information systems that streamline observation and data collection on livestock numbers, pasture infrastructure, and other key indicators.

"We shared our tools with the participants of the UNCCD Conference of the Parties and presented our experience at a round table organized jointly with the People and Nature Foundation (Russia). That is the primary benefit of such events—experts from different countries gather on a single platform to exchange practical information and engage in meaningful discussion," shared Maksat Miynazarov.

Summarizing the broadcast, the participants emphasized that overcoming land degradation and preserving pastures as a viable ecosystem requires responsible stewardship from farmers and herders themselves. After all, if a site is sown with high-quality seeds and livestock is immediately allowed to graze on the young sprouts, the recovery process will be undone and take significantly longer.
